To start off, I have sensitive, acne-prone, oily/combination skin. I'd recommend this product to anyone with sensitive and/or acne-prone skin seeking an affordable toner. This product is available in two sizes - 3.3 fl. oz. for $10 and 8.4 fl. oz. for $22. Since the product comes with a pump, it's relatively easy to dispense the desired amount. I use this product twice a day after cleansing my face, where I'd dispense two to three pumps onto a cotton pad to rid of any excess makeup, dirt or oil left on my face. Having a toner in my skincare routine again has shown me the amount of excess makeup, dirt or oil left on my face that can potentially lead to breakouts. I've tried several department store toners, where I've experienced acne and flakiness as a result. After using this product, my skin feels clean and refreshed. I've found the 3.3 fl. oz. bottle lasting anywhere between six to eight months. I have been using this product for a little over a year and am glad I stumbled upon this product; I am no longer on the hunt for an affordable toner that doesn't break me out. :)

Last month, when I finally took the plunge and bought my beloved Ocean Salt, the very eccentric sales associate offered me a sample of the Breath of Fresh Air toner, which she said was her favorite product to use in conjunction with Ocean Salt. Lush says that Breath of Fresh Air will "give your skin a new lease on life with a blend of ingredients inspired by the sea. Breath of Fresh Air is suitable for all skin types, but is particularly beneficial for faces that have been ravaged by the elements. A gentle spray refreshes you when you need it most and brings all the nutrients of the sea directly to the skin. Fresh sea water gently cleanses while carragen seaweed extract softens and provides essential vitamins and minerals. And all the while rose absolute an aloe vera are soothing dry areas". For the most part, the ingredients are natural. Breath of Fresh Air is available in two sizes; 3.3 fl oz ($9.95), and 8.4 fl oz ($21.95). Like I mentioned, I got a little free sample with a purchase. As we all know, Lush is a cruelty free brand that focuses on "fresh", organic, and natural products, a large majority of which cater to vegans. This toner was made in Canada. Lush products can be bought at Lush stores and kiosks, and through the brand's website.
The full size of Breath of Fresh Air comes in a black spray bottle. The standard Lush label wraps around the bottle, featuring the product name, a description, and ingredient list. I'm not a fan of spray on toners, I'd likely be spraying it onto a cotton round. The packaging for this toner is recyclable, but I don't think its eligible for Lush's in-store recyclable program.
I'm a dedicated user of Olay's Oil Minimizing Toner, so I was feeling pretty neutral about Breath of Fresh Air. The first time I used this toner, it felt amazing! Slightly tingly, in a good way, and kinda firming. I thought it was love at first use. Sadly, the next several uses didn't really wow me. The pleasant tingle and toned feel seem to have been a one time deal. To me, the point of a toner is to pick up the last bits of cleanser and makeup that haven't been rinsed away, purifying the skin before you apply moisturizer. I just don't feel like this toner does that. The Lush sales associate also told me that you need to use less moisturizer when you use Breath of Fresh Air, a claim that also doesn't seem to hold up. What I do think Breath of Fresh Air is good for is absorbing excess oil without stripping the skin. This toner is quite gentle and is alcohol free, so it may be a good choice for those with sensitive skin. Breath of Fresh Air smells really similar to the BB Seaweed Fresh Face Mask, which makes sense since they share seaweed, rose, rosemary, and aloe as common ingredients.
I'm not in love with Lush's Breath of Fresh Air Toner. I feel like it isn't particularly effective at anything but removing oil. This is the most gentle toner I've ever sampled, it doesn't sting at all, so its excellent for those who can't handle alcoholic toners. I wouldn't repurchase this toner, but I did finish off my little sample.

I hadn't used a proper toner before, but I did try to take good care of my skin. I always remove my makeup, then I wash my face with a facewash and rinse thourougly with water. Then I would apply eyecream and a moisturizer.

I got this toner because I just wanted to try one, I have used some alcohol based tonics before, but they broke me out.

As soon as I used this, my skin cleared. I didn't have bad skin, just a spot here and there most of the time. but using this toner made my skin clear and even. Everytime I stop using this product, my skin becomes more uneven and I get a few more spots.

I use this by spritsing two pumps of product on my hands, and then pad that all over my face and neck. This way no product gets wasted on cotton pads. Also, I doubt this takes makeup off, so use it as a skincare item. I suggest you use a alcohol based tonic or a cleansing milk for taking makeup off.

Because it helped my skin so much, I will continue to repurchase this (I am on my second bottle).

I did take one lippie off because it contains perfume (quite high on the list too), and that's just not good for the skin. otherwise, it contains some types of water, a few oils and plant extracts and the last ingredient is parabens, to keep it fresh.

Pricewise I think it's okay priced, I do have to order it and I would like it to be cheaper. But since a 100ml lasted me around 6 months with everyday use, I think the price is alright.

I do think the packaging sucks. I tried spraying it in my face, but it comes out in big drops, so you get a splash in your eye instead of a nice fine mist all over. Because the packaging is black, you can't really tell how much is left. And I find the packaging very unattractive. The only good thing is that the black plastic prevents the product from breaking down through sunlight, and it's made from recycled stuff.

overall I would recommend you to try this product as an extra step in your skincare. It definitely helped my skin. There is a small 100ml version and a large one. So just get the small one for starters, it lasted me for ages.
